Subject: Handover — Slateboard solver

Hi Renko,

Taking leave next week, so the Slateboard timetable solver is yours. Two schools reported overlapping class assignments after Friday's run; the constraint table likely has stale room records. Re-run the validation job first, then clear any flagged rows before the next solve. All solver state sits in the scheduling database, which you can reach with the connection string below.

replica DSN, kajep-yahag: mssql://praok_svc:iF@db-8d68.plorvaio.local:5432/eliion

Q: The Haulwright fleet fuel-usage report is empty — what gives? A: Usually the nightly import didn't run. Check the ingest log on the reports box; if the last entry is older than 24h, rerun fuel-import manually. Empty rows with zero liters mean the telematics feed sent nulls — filter those, don't delete them. Numbers are liters, not gallons; don't convert. Manual reruns require unlocking the ingest keystore first, and the keystore accepts only the recovery passphrase provided below.

strongbox words: zorath-holmir

Test-plan note: Health checks behind the Brindlegate LB

For the on-call rotation: these tests validate that the load balancer correctly drains a node when `/healthz` returns 503 twice within the 10-second window. Run them only against the staging pool, never production. Verify that removed nodes stop receiving traffic within 15 seconds and rejoin after two consecutive 200s. The health endpoint on staging requires authentication, and the check harness presents the bearer token below.

portal login ticket: eyJhbGciOiJIUzI1NiIsInR5cCI6IkpXVCJ9.eyJzdWIiOiIMjvRAf3PEFIn0.nuv9gjixLtnr